CrawlJobs Logo

Staff Software Engineer, Catalog Platform

uber.com Logo

Uber

Location Icon

Location:
Denmark , Aarhus

Category Icon

Job Type Icon

Contract Type:
Not provided

Salary Icon

Salary:

Not provided

Job Description:

Whether it’s a sandwich, a burrito, or groceries, the Uber Eats team builds technology to connect people with what they want, when and where they want it. Uber Eats is home to a team of engineers tasked with creating an app to fuel our three-sided marketplace of eaters, delivery-partners, and restaurants.

Job Responsibility:

  • Build the Product Catalog and Inventory system that powers the Uber Delivery experience, and related verticals, such as groceries.
  • This is one of the foundational components of the Uber Delivery architecture, as it interfaces with merchants, powers our product search, and serves recommendations to our customers.
  • The system is designed to be highly-available and highly-scalable to support our global operation 24/7.

Requirements:

  • Relevant degree (B.Sc, M.Sc, Ph.D) in Computer Science or related technical field or equivalent practical experience (8+ years)
  • Experience coding with C++, Java, Python, or Go
  • Enjoy building high quality software that is relied upon by millions of people around the world.
  • Comfortable working with ambiguity in constantly evolving environment
  • Experience working in large scale distributed systems

Nice to have:

  • Experience in building performant distributed systems with focus on correctness and consistency
  • Experience with distributed databases
  • Experience with large-scale eCommerce or Content-Management Systems
  • Batch and/or Streaming computation platforms
  • (Openness to) Fullstack experience

Additional Information:

Job Posted:
February 17, 2026

Work Type:
On-site work
Job Link Share:
PREMIUM
More languages and countries
+ Unlock 31694 hidden job offers
Languages
English Čeština Deutsch Ελληνικά Español Français +15
Countries
United States United Kingdom India Canada Australia +
See plans
Plans from $2.99 / month

Looking for more opportunities? Search for other job offers that match your skills and interests.

Briefcase Icon

Similar Jobs for Staff Software Engineer, Catalog Platform

Staff Software Engineer

We’re looking for a Staff Software Engineer to join our Aiven Unify team. Aiven ...
Location
Location
Finland , Helsinki
Salary
Salary:
Not provided
aiven.io Logo
Aiven Deutschland GmbH
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Strong experience building and operating managed services or SaaS platforms (single- or multi-tenant): tenancy models, and incident management
  • Hands-on engineering skills, particularly in: Python for service orchestration, platform development and ingestion
  • REST API design and integration — building, securing, and maintaining user facing, service-to-service APIs
  • Java languages (Java) for improvements and integrations of managed services
  • React/TypeScript for occasional Console UI enhancements
  • Experience with metadata, catalog, or data pipeline systems: relational databases (PostgreSQL/MySQL), search engines (OpenSearch/Elasticsearch), and event logs (Kafka)
  • Cloud and platform experience: Terraform/IaC, networking (VPC peering/BYOC), observability, and cost optimization
  • Security mindset: experience with access control, audit trails, GDPR, ISO, and SOC2 compliance
  • Product sense and delivery focus: ability to work iteratively with design partners and turn concepts into customer-ready services
Job Responsibility
Job Responsibility
  • Design and own the architecture for running managed services (including VPC support), backed by Aiven-managed data systems (Kafka®, OpenSearch®, PostgreSQL®, and other technologies)
  • Ensure reliability and resilience: design failover mechanisms, deployment patterns, upgrade strategies, and observability for metrics, logs, and traces
  • Develop and maintain ingestion pipelines and connectors (primarily in Python) to collect and synchronize metadata across Aiven services
  • Implement identity and access control synchronization, aligning Aiven’s Teams and Roles with catalog-level RBAC/ABAC policies across APIs and UIs
  • Collaborate cross-functionally with Product, Design, Security, and Platform teams to define SLOs, readiness checklists, and operational runbooks
  • Iteratively build the product 0 from PoC through LA to GA — balancing speed, quality, and long-term maintainability
  • Contribute across the stack where needed: Python for orchestration, Java for service improvements and fixes, and React/TypeScript for Console experience improvements
  • Coach and mentor engineers, set technical standards, and shape the engineering culture for the new product line
What we offer
What we offer
  • Participate in Aiven’s equity plan
  • With Aiven locations spanning the globe, we want all of our crabs to find the right balance with our hybrid work policy
  • Get the equipment you need to set yourself up for success
  • Step up your career game with real employer support (use one of our learning platforms, annual learning budget, and more)
  • Get holistic wellbeing support through our global Employee Assistance Program
  • Your wellbeing matters: we provide extensive Occupational Health Care, Dental Care, as well as sports, culture, massage and lunch benefits
  • Love breakfast? So do we! Join us at our regular office breakfast
  • We also have you covered by statutory accident insurance
  • Fulltime
Read More
Arrow Right

Senior Staff Software Engineer: Data & Storage Platform

Uber’s Data Platform is the heart of the company’s critical decision-making and ...
Location
Location
United States , Seattle; San Francisco; Sunnyvale
Salary
Salary:
267000.00 - 297000.00 USD / Year
uber.com Logo
Uber
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• 14+ Years of Engineering Excellence: Proven experience designing and operating world-class distributed data and storage systems
  • Mastery of Storage Internals: Extensive storage experience is a must
  • Deep expertise in: Batch & Object Storage: HDFS, Cloud Object Storage (S3/GCS/OCI), and Blobstore metadata management
  • Storage Optimization: Practical experience with Apache Hudi or Apache Iceberg for lakehouse architectures
  • Transactional Systems: Experience with distributed transactional storage (e.g., Docstore, Google Spanner, TiDB)
  • NoSQL & Cache: Cassandra, Redis, and high-throughput Key-Value stores
  • Data + AI Convergence: Deep understanding of how compute fabrics (Spark, Flink, Ray) integrate with vector databases and model-serving platforms
  • Query Engine Proficiency: Architect-level knowledge of Presto, Trino, or Hive for large-scale analytical processing
  • Systems Programming: Expert-level command of Java, Go, Scala, or C++ with a focus on performance tuning and distributed consensus
Job Responsibility
Job Responsibility
  • Architect the Multi-Modal Fabric: Unify batch, streaming, and AI compute into one intelligent fabric, enabling real-time insights and trustworthy AI agents at a global scale
  • Revolutionize Storage & Catalog: Drive the architecture for a unified catalog and metadata management service for unstructured data, leveraging native cloud object store capabilities
  • Operationalize AI Intelligence: Partner with teams like QueryCopilot and DataIQ to bridge human validation with autonomous reasoning through agentic workflows
  • Lead Storage Modernization: Evolve our massive-scale persistence layers—including Docstore (Transactional Distributed Storage) and Distributed MySQL—to increase resiliency and reduce operational overhead
  • Open Source & Act as a force multiplier by contributing to the community (Hudi, Iceberg, Presto)
What we offer
What we offer
  • Eligible to participate in Uber's bonus program
  • May be offered an equity award & other types of comp
  • All full-time employees are eligible to participate in a 401(k) plan
  • Eligible for various benefits
  • Fulltime
Read More
Arrow Right

Senior Staff Data Engineer- Data Platform

At Marktplaats, data is at the heart of everything we do, but Intelligence is wh...
Location
Location
Netherlands , Amsterdam
Salary
Salary:
Not provided
adevinta.com Logo
Adevinta
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• 10+ years of hands-on experience in Software Development or Data Engineering
  • at least 5+ years specifically focused on building Data Platforms
  • deep understanding of how Platform infra supports Analytics workloads
  • proven experience evolving complex platforms from legacy patterns to modern, cloud-native solutions
  • deep knowledge of Spark internals, JVM tuning, and performance optimization for high-scale batch and streaming datasets
  • deep expertise in Unity Catalog, Delta Lake internals, and optimizing high-volume workloads
  • strict software engineering discipline (CI/CD, Testing, OOP) applied to data pipelines
  • understanding of microservices architecture
  • understanding the needs of Analytics/DWH teams (Data Modeling, dbt)
  • strong background in building automated pipelines using Terraform/Terragrunt and ensuring system observability
Job Responsibility
Job Responsibility
  • Lead the evolution of our Data Platform and architect the "Data Exchange" strategy
  • define robust patterns for API-based ingestion, Event-Driven Architectures (Kafka), and Reverse ETL
  • ensure architectures are optimized for cost and performance on AWS
  • act as a catalyst for technical evolution
  • constantly scan the horizon for next-generation technologies
  • lead the implementation of new paradigms
  • design the strategy for Unity Catalog implementation and Data Contracts
  • champion FinOps, automating cost controls for our highest-volume workloads
  • build the underlying infrastructure that allows Analytics/DWH teams to run efficient transformations
  • elevate the technical bar of the team, mentoring Staff and Senior engineers
What we offer
What we offer
  • An attractive Base Salary
  • Participation in our Short Term Incentive plan (annual bonus)
  • Work From Anywhere: Enjoy up to 20 days a year of working from anywhere
  • A 24/7 Employee Assistance Program for you and your family
  • a collaborative environment with an opportunity to explore your potential and grow
  • a range of locally relevant benefits
  • Fulltime
Read More
Arrow Right

Staff Software Engineer, Managed AI - AI Platform

Be a part of the AI revolution with sustainable technology at Crusoe. Here, you'...
Location
Location
United States , San Francisco, CA; Sunnyvale, CA
Salary
Salary:
208725.00 - 253000.00 USD / Year
crusoe.ai Logo
Crusoe
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Advanced degree in Computer Science/Engineering
  • 8-10+ years of industry experience with demonstrated history of consistent success leading a varied portfolio of initiatives across your function
  • Experience with distributed systems, cloud services (compute, storage, networking, database), and delivering early-stage projects quickly
  • Experience with Generative AI (LLMs, Multimodal) and familiar with AI infrastructure (training, inference, ETL pipelines)
  • Proficient with container runtimes (e.g., Kubernetes), microservices, REST APIs, gRPC, and the full software development lifecycle including CI/CD
Job Responsibility
Job Responsibility
  • Lead the design and implementation of core AI services, including: Resilient fault-tolerant queues for efficient task distribution
  • Model catalogs for managing and versioning AI models
  • Scheduling mechanisms optimized for cost and performance
  • Architect and scale infrastructure to handle millions of API requests per second
  • Implement robust monitoring and alerting to ensure system health and 24/7 availability
  • Collaborate closely with product management, business strategy, and other engineering teams to define the AI platform roadmap
  • Influence the long-term vision and architectural decisions of the platform
  • Contribute to open-source AI frameworks and actively participate in the AI community
  • Prototype and rapidly iterate on emerging technologies and new features
What we offer
What we offer
  • Restricted Stock Units in a fast growing, well-funded technology company
  • Health insurance package options that include HDHP and PPO, vision, and dental for you and your dependents
  • Employer contributions to HSA accounts
  • Paid Parental Leave
  • Paid life insurance, short-term and long-term disability
  • Teladoc
  • 401(k) with a 100% match up to 4% of salary
  • Generous paid time off and holiday schedule
  • Cell phone reimbursement
  • Tuition reimbursement
  • Fulltime
Read More
Arrow Right
New

Senior Software Engineer: Data Engineering, GCP, GenAI

Wells Fargo is seeking Senior Software Engineer.
Location
Location
India , Hyderabad
Salary
Salary:
Not provided
https://www.wellsfargo.com/ Logo
Wells Fargo
Expiration Date
May 26, 2026
Flip Icon
Requirements
Requirements
  • 4+ years of Software Engineering experience, or equivalent demonstrated through one or a combination of the following: work experience, training, military experience, education
  • Google Cloud Platform (GCP)
  • BigQuery, Dataproc / Apache Spark, Bigtable, Dataplex / Data Catalog
  • Python (ETL/ELT pipelines and automation)
  • SQL (data transformation, validation, and reconciliation)
  • Databases: MySQL, Hive, MongoDB
  • Cloud Composer / Apache Airflow
  • Kafka and Google Pub/Sub
  • Apigee / REST APIs (data extraction and integration)
  • GenAI (LLMs, embeddings, prompt engineering) and how they integrate with data platforms
Job Responsibility
Job Responsibility
  • Lead moderately complex initiatives and deliverables within technical domain environments
  • Contribute to large scale planning of strategies
  • Design, code, test, debug, and document for projects and programs associated with technology domain, including upgrades and deployments
  • Review moderately complex technical challenges that require an in-depth evaluation of technologies and procedures
  • Resolve moderately complex issues and lead a team to meet existing client needs or potential new clients needs while leveraging solid understanding of the function, policies, procedures, or compliance requirements
  • Collaborate and consult with peers, colleagues, and mid-level managers to resolve technical challenges and achieve goals
  • Lead projects and act as an escalation point, provide guidance and direction to less experienced staff
  • Fulltime
!
Read More
Arrow Right

Staff Data Engineer

In the Marktplaats data and analytics teams, data is at the heart of everything ...
Location
Location
Netherlands , Amsterdam
Salary
Salary:
Not provided
adevinta.com Logo
Adevinta
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• 10+ years of hands-on experience in Software Development/Data Engineering
  • Experience with Databricks (Lakehouse, ML/MosaicAI, Unity Catalog, MLflow, Mosaic AI, model serving etc)
  • Proven experience on building cloud native data intensive applications (both real time and batch based)
  • AWS experience is preferred
  • Strong background in Data Engineering to support other Data Engineers, Back Enders and Data Scientists
  • Hands-on experience of building and maintaining Spark applications
  • Python and PySpark(Scala Spark is a plus)
  • Experienced in AWS Cloud usage and data management (automation, data governance, cost optimisation, delivering reliable & scalable data solutions)
  • Ensure data quality, schema governance and monitoring across pipelines
  • Experience with orchestrators such as Airflow, Databricks workflows
Job Responsibility
Job Responsibility
  • Independently develop and deliver high-quality features for our new Data/ML Platform
  • Refactor and translate our data products and finish various tasks to a high standard
  • Be the cornerstone of the platform’s reliability, scalability and performance
  • Work hands on with batch and streaming data pipelines, storage solutions and APIs that serve complex analytical and ML workloads
  • Encompass ownership of the self-serve data platform, including data collection, lake management, orchestration, processing, and distribution
What we offer
What we offer
  • An attractive Base Salary
  • Participation in our Short Term Incentive plan (annual bonus)
  • Work From Anywhere: Enjoy up to 20 days a year of working from anywhere
  • A 24/7 Employee Assistance Program for you and your family
  • A collaborative environment with an opportunity to explore your potential and grow
  • A range of locally relevant benefits
  • Fulltime
Read More
Arrow Right

Staff Software Engineer, Forward Deployed

As a Forward Deployed Engineer (FDE) for our U.S. Public Sector team at Invisibl...
Location
Location
United States , Washington DC–Baltimore; Reston, VA
Salary
Salary:
191000.00 - 279000.00 USD / Year
invisible.co Logo
Invisible Technologies
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Active U.S. Department of Defense Secret clearance or higher
  • 8+ years of software engineering experience, including work on data-intensive, ML, or backend systems
  • Experience leading requirements-gathering activities and translating stakeholder input into technical specifications
  • Python & ML/LLM frameworks: Hands-on experience with Python and modern ML/LLM tooling (e.g., Hugging Face, LangChain, OpenAI, Pinecone)
  • Deployment & infrastructure: Experience building and operating API-based services using Docker, FastAPI, Kubernetes, and major cloud platforms (AWS, GCP)
  • Platform & data management: Familiarity with workflow orchestration, pub/sub systems (e.g., Kafka), schema governance, data contracts, Unity Catalog, Delta/ETL pipelines, and replay processes
  • Ability to work on-site 2–3 days per week at offices located in the greater Washington, D.C. and Reston, VA area
Job Responsibility
Job Responsibility
  • Scope, design, and lead implementation of AI-driven solutions in partnership with delivery teams and executive stakeholders
  • Translate ambiguous workflows and business needs into repeatable systems and production-ready technical architectures
  • Lead architecture design and trade-off discussions across performance, scalability, cost, and reliability
  • Build usable systems from messy data and incomplete or evolving requirements
  • Apply AI/ML solutions in highly regulated environments (e.g., defense, intelligence, healthcare, finance)
  • Own projects end-to-end—from initial discovery and scoping through implementation, deployment, and post-launch iteration
  • Build shared infrastructure, reusable components, and internal playbooks to improve delivery consistency and team velocity
  • Mentor mid-level engineers and contribute to the development of forward-deployed AI engineering practices at Invisible
What we offer
What we offer
  • Bonuses and equity are included in offers above entry level
  • Fulltime
Read More
Arrow Right

Staff Data Engineer

In the Marktplaats data and analytics teams, data is at the heart of everything ...
Location
Location
Netherlands , Amsterdam
Salary
Salary:
Not provided
adevinta.com Logo
Adevinta
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• 10+ years of hands-on experience in Software Development/Data Engineering
  • Experience with Databricks (Lakehouse, ML/MosaicAI, Unity Catalog, MLflow, Mosaic AI, model serving etc)
  • Proven experience on building cloud native data intensive applications (both real time and batch based)
  • AWS experience is preferred
  • Strong background in Data Engineering to support other Data Engineers, Back Enders and Data Scientists in building data products and services
  • Hands-on experience of building and maintaining Spark applications
  • Python and PySpark(Scala Spark is a plus)
  • Experienced in AWS Cloud usage and data management (automation, data governance, cost optimisation, delivering reliable & scalable data solutions)
  • Ensure data quality, schema governance and monitoring across pipelines
  • Experience with orchestrators such as Airflow, Databricks workflows
Job Responsibility
Job Responsibility
  • Independently develop and deliver high-quality features for our new Data/ML Platform
  • Refactor and translate our data products and finish various tasks to a high standard
  • Be the cornerstone of the platform’s reliability, scalability and performance
  • Work hands on with batch and streaming data pipelines, storage solutions and APIs that serve complex analytical and ML workloads
  • Encompass ownership of the self-serve data platform, including data collection, lake management, orchestration, processing, and distribution
What we offer
What we offer
  • An attractive Base Salary
  • Participation in our Short Term Incentive plan (annual bonus)
  • Work From Anywhere: Enjoy up to 20 days a year of working from anywhere
  • A 24/7 Employee Assistance Program for you and your family
  • A collaborative environment with an opportunity to explore your potential and grow
  • A range of locally relevant benefits
  • Fulltime
Read More
Arrow Right